Javascript 打开带有本地URL的选项卡时加载CSS文件

Javascript 打开带有本地URL的选项卡时加载CSS文件,javascript,css,firefox-addon,firefox-addon-sdk,Javascript,Css,Firefox Addon,Firefox Addon Sdk,我正在打开一个选项卡,该选项卡从加载项(使用加载项sdk)加载本地HTML文件,如下所示: tabs.open({ url: self.data.url('index.html'), onReady: myScript }); 但是我没有看到加载与HTML文件一起使用的CSS样式表的方法。我希望不必编写内联样式 我错过什么了吗?当然有一种方法可以使用API加载CSS。将此添加到index.html的部分以包含CSS <link rel="stylesheet" type="tex

我正在打开一个选项卡,该选项卡从加载项(使用加载项sdk)加载本地HTML文件,如下所示:

tabs.open({
  url: self.data.url('index.html'),
  onReady: myScript
});
但是我没有看到加载与HTML文件一起使用的CSS样式表的方法。我希望不必编写内联样式

我错过什么了吗?当然有一种方法可以使用API加载CSS。

将此添加到
index.html
部分以包含CSS

<link rel="stylesheet" type="text/css" href="your_css_file.css">


CSS文件通常是从HTML中链接而来的。我会被诅咒的,这是有效的。很明显,我首先尝试了,但是没有成功,我认为插件sdk在幕后做了一些特别的事情,可能是某种沙箱。